Flying from London Stansted
Stansted is built around Ryanair, with over 200 routes and the airport's single Norman Foster terminal optimised for fast turnarounds. The Stansted Express runs to Liverpool Street in 47 minutes; the airport sits 34 miles northeast of central London. Fares from Stansted are typically the cheapest of the London airports, especially on Eastern European, Italian and Iberian routes — the trade-off is fewer full-service options and a longer ground transfer at both ends.
Arriving in Crete
Heraklion Airport is 4 km east of central Heraklion, the largest city in Crete. Bus 1 runs every 15 minutes to the city centre. The May–October leisure schedule is intense; winter capacity drops sharply but doesn't disappear. Crete's size means you can fly into Heraklion (HER) or Chania (CHQ) — match the airport to your accommodation cluster to save the 2-hour cross-island drive.

UK passport holders generally do not need a visa for short stays in Greece (Schengen-area members allow 90 days in any 180-day window). ETIAS pre-authorisation will apply once live for European destinations. Always check gov.uk/foreign-travel-advice/greece before booking.
